Cavoni-Ginestreto, Calabria, Italy

Overview

Cavoni-Ginestreto is a picturesque village in Calabria, Italy, blending rich tradition with seaside allure. Its historic core and tranquil surroundings offer visitors a taste of quiet local life against the backdrop of olive groves and the Ionian coast.

Best Time to Visit

April-June or September-October for mild weather and fewer tourists.

Local Tips

Cash is preferred at small shops; many places close for siesta in the afternoon. Try the local olive oil and homemade gelato.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is appreciated but not obligatory (round up or leave small change). Dress casually but modestly in churches. Greet shopkeepers with 'Buongiorno.'

Safety Warnings

Pickpocketing is rare but keep an eye on valuables at the marina. Some beachside roads are poorly lit at night; avoid walking alone late.

Hidden Gems

The rustic San Giorgio Chapel with frescoes, hillside hiking trails with sea views, and a family-run ceramic studio in Artigiani Quarter.
